Amid the continuing rise in COVID-19 cases in the country, President Rodrigo Duterte announced on Friday that Metro Manila and 12 other areas would remain under general community quarantine (GCQ)
The government also announced that it may ease restrictions on more business establishments—although more health protocols may be imposed—in a bid to contain the rising infections in the country as well as the economic recession that has rendered at least seven million Filipinos jobless.
In a recorded television footage released on Friday morning, President Duterte announced the extension of the GCQ upon the recommendation of the Inter-Agency Task Force for the Management of Emerging Infectious Diseases . “There are many infections. You keep on going out, the transmission will be endless. Anyway there’s the vaccine,” Mr. Duterte said, apparently referring to a still nonexistent vaccine that China promised to provide the Philippines once it is available.
